What is Spring Brook House?
Spring Brook House consists of 29 retirement apartments, located in the town of Accrington near the picturesque Ribble Valley in Lancashire.
Operated by Housing 21, Spring Brook House offers independent living to its elderly residents and features a number of communal areas and facilities.
Who are Housing 21?
Housing 21 are not-for-profit organisation that provides Retirement Housing and Extra Care for older people.
They have a presence in almost 200 local authority areas and manage a portfolio of approximately 20,000 retirement and extra care living properties in the UK.
Housing 21 are “committed to providing a modern, forward-thinking 21st century service” that “includes updating and modernising their existing housing as well as developing new and innovative property designs and service models for the future.”

What works are Novus Undertaking at Spring Brook House?
The overall objective of the project was to improve the fire safety of the building alongside achieving the complete modernisation of the communal of the building and welfare areas.
Specifically, these building refurbishments included:
- Fire Stopping works
- Installation of new fire doors
- Installation of new suspended ceilings and lighting
- Full internal redecoration (including painting and decorating)
- Relocation of the manager’s office
- New kitchen installation
- Upgraded dining and living rooms
